summaryrefslogtreecommitdiff
path: root/security/nss/lib/base/base.h
diff options
context:
space:
mode:
authorian.mcgreer%sun.com <devnull@localhost>2001-09-25 20:48:51 +0000
committerian.mcgreer%sun.com <devnull@localhost>2001-09-25 20:48:51 +0000
commitc39539cba1e146fb05e05f89bef9f44cc118c609 (patch)
treee33d181b3b437b1a6577ecfa11d31021bfd19a83 /security/nss/lib/base/base.h
parente0938bb1bae0dd0182687abad386a227b1bc05cc (diff)
downloadnss-hg-c39539cba1e146fb05e05f89bef9f44cc118c609.tar.gz
check in the nssItem_ interface
Diffstat (limited to 'security/nss/lib/base/base.h')
-rw-r--r--security/nss/lib/base/base.h33
1 files changed, 33 insertions, 0 deletions
diff --git a/security/nss/lib/base/base.h b/security/nss/lib/base/base.h
index 14973830d..591fd35da 100644
--- a/security/nss/lib/base/base.h
+++ b/security/nss/lib/base/base.h
@@ -546,6 +546,39 @@ nss_ClearErrorStack
);
/*
+ * NSSItem
+ *
+ * nssItem_Create
+ * nssItem_Duplicate
+ * nssItem_Equal
+ */
+
+NSS_EXTERN NSSItem *
+nssItem_Create
+(
+ NSSArena *arenaOpt,
+ NSSItem *rvOpt,
+ PRUint32 length,
+ const void *data
+);
+
+NSS_EXTERN NSSItem *
+nssItem_Duplicate
+(
+ NSSItem *obj,
+ NSSArena *arenaOpt,
+ NSSItem *rvOpt
+);
+
+NSS_EXTERN PRBool
+nssItem_Equal
+(
+ const NSSItem *one,
+ const NSSItem *two,
+ PRStatus *statusOpt
+);
+
+/*
* NSSUTF8
*
* nssUTF8_CaseIgnoreMatch